Red Wing’s line of Heritage boots all boast premium leather, resoleable welts so that you can maintain these boots for several years, and heavy-duty stitching. While the Classic Moc and Classic Chelsea are both solid options, the most popular Red Wing Heritage boots are definitely the Blacksmith and the Iron Ranger. With distinctive cap-toe and nickel-plated eyelets, the Red Wing Heritage Iron Ranger Boots are a stunning option that catches the eye.

This timeless classic manages to nail a perfect mixture of ruggedness and elegance, giving it a range of style for those who wear it. The Iron Ranger is definitely a thicker boot, however, the slim sole and full-grain leather upper allow for the boot to retain its classic appeal. Also, these boots are made from Amber Harness and Roughout leather, which can be a bit of a hassle to break in.

However, after a few months, the leather patinas quite nicely, giving you a perfect surface. While the Blacksmith is nearly identical to the Iron Ranger, there are a few key differences between the two. For example, the Red Wing Blacksmiths do not feature cap-toe, adding some extra wiggle-room to the boot and also giving them a slightly sleeker appearance.

Another way to recognize a Blacksmith is by the brass hardware, which tends to complement a variety of leather colors more than the nickel. The Red Wing Heritage Blacksmith’s come in a handful of different leather types, none of which are as iconic as the Iron Ranger’s options. However, the most popular leathers for the Blacksmith boots are briar slick, black prairie, and roughout.

Chinos are a type of trouser that is known for being very lightweight and simple. Being that they are neither formal nor informal, they are incredibly versatile, able to be worn for a variety of settings such as semi-casual and business casual environments. Most often they are made from cotton-twill material, giving them a simple and soft feel.

Sometimes, chinos can also be recognized by some more basic, everyday features such as patch pockets or decorative stitchings. Also, while many men are not aware of this, chinos that come in a khaki color are usually called khaki’s, not chinos. Khaki’s are also known to use cotton that is a much heavier weight than regular chinos, creating a more easily recognized distinction between the two. 

Modern chinos are known to have a slimmer fit and silhouette than more traditional chinos. Though these trousers first became popular with both the American and British armies before making their way into mainstream fashion, they are now a solid go-to choice for men who like to keep things simple yet stylish. Also, while the cotton-twill material mentioned above is the most common fabric that chinos come in, they are also sometimes available in moleskin, wool, and corduroy.

Most commonly made from leather, Chelsea boots are ankle boots that have an elastic gore panel on the sides for greater flexibility and comfort. In general, Chelsea boots come in two different styles with one being a thicker and chunkier shape with a rounded toe box, and the other a slimmer, more European style with a narrower toe box. Though the thicker style might be considered a bit more heavy-duty and stabilizing, the European style is definitely the appropriate option for more formal attire.

It is even possible to wear them with a suit when styled properly. When it comes to the sole of the shoe, most Chelsea boots feature a leather sole, but rubber soles are becoming increasingly popular. Chelsea boots are also known for having an extremely clean silhouette that makes them appear very sleek and suave.  

Chukka Boots

Leather,Shoes,Italian,Chukka,Boots

Chukka boots are also ankle boots, though they feature a lace-up system in the front. Also, while they are commonly leather, they are also available in suede and sometimes even canvas uppers. They are definitely a great option to have during the cooler months as they provide nice durability and solid insulation.

The most distinguishing feature of chukka boots is certainly the lacing, though a couple of brands have attempted to create chukka boots with a slip-on design. Whether you want to wear them with chinos or jeans, chukka boots can be worn in a wide array of settings, however, they are not as easily paired with suits or very formal attire. 

The Differences Between the Two

Differences-Between-Chelsea-Boots-and-Chukka-Boots

There is no denying that chukka boots are much more versatile than Chelsea boots, meaning if you are only able to purchase one pair, chukka boots will likely get you further and pair better with more outfit options. However, when it comes to putting together a fancier ensemble, Chelsea boots tend to be the better option due to their slim fit and streamlined construction. While both boots are considered “dress boots,” they each have a distinguished style and look that you’ll want to pay close attention to before making a decision.

Chelsea boots are also known for being a bit more modern due to their unique, laceless design. Finally, chukka boots tend to have a lower ankle than Chelsea boots and they maintain a classic and elegant look while still being more unique than a typical pair of Oxfords or loafers. Slim fit pants are known for being a more consistent style and fit across various brands. When it comes to the leg opening, slim fit trousers generally have a leg opening that is a bit smaller than the top part of the pant leg and then taper below the knee.

As the name suggests, they are designed to be more form fitting, therefore they are not the fit that you’re going to want to go for something a bit more loose or comfortable. Though slim fit pants are not necessarily skin tight (like skinny jeans), they are fitted enough to show some definition and shape. 

Slim Straight Fit

Slim-straight-fit-pants

Slim straight fit pants are very similar to slim fit trousers, however, they are slightly looser. Basically, the pants still hug the knees just as they do in a pair of slim fits, but the leg flares out more. Unlike straight fit jeans, where they do not hug but are rather form fitted, a slim straight fit still appears tighter and accentuates the body.

Though the differences are subtle, those who pay close attention to detail will catch them. Also, the wearer of the jeans or trousers will be able to feel a difference in comfort level when comparing slim fit pants and slim straight fit pants.

A wingtip shoe can easily be defined as any shoe that has a wing-shaped line of stitching along the upper part of the shoe. This stitching essentially creates an artificial border between the toe box and vamp of the shoe. Considered great for smart-casual or business-casual attire, wingtips tend to have nice detailing and decorative perforations, though not all wingtips have this. If a pair of wingtip shoes do have these perforations, they can also be referred to as brogues. However, simple dress-shoes that have just a wingtip stitching are not brogues and should not be labeled as such. While several dress shoes tend to be set in one solid color, wingtips, along with cap toes, give you a bit more room for funkiness and flexibility. Multi-colored Oxfords are a great example of that versatile stitching having a creative twist put on it. Having a white toe that contrasts with a black or brown body add some extra flair to any formal or business-casual outfit. 

Cap Toe Shoes

A,Closeup,Of,A,Groomsman,Wearing,Cap,Toe,Shoes

Similar to wingtip shoes, cap toes can best be defined as having a line of stitches separating the toe area from the rest of the shoe. However, rather than having the W-shaped line that you’ll find with wingtips, cap toe’s specifically use stitching that forms a horizontal line. In addition to this, there are a few different features that seem to remain common throughout most cap toe shoes, making it easier to identify them when you are shopping. First, most cap toe dress shoes come in a rather standard set of color variations. Second, cap toe dress shoes are also most commonly made from either leather or suede, with leather being a bit more formal and suede being more casual. In addition, you are more likely to find some sort of decorative pattern or perforations across the toe box. 

Differences Between the Two

Men,Footwear,Fashion.,Variety,Of,Male’s,Shoes,On,Shelf,In

Clearly, the biggest distinction between cap toe shoes and wingtip shoes lies in the stitching on the upper. If the stitching on the shoe is a straight, horizontal line, then you are looking at a cap toe. If the stitching is one in a W or wing-shaped line, you’ve got a wingtip on your hands. Though both shoes tend to come in similar colors and be made of either leather or suede, wingtips are generally considered more casual than cap toe shoes due to their funkier design. If you are ever attending a very formal event and are unsure of which to go with, remember that it is better to be overdressed than underdressed, meaning you should go with the cap toe shoes.

There is no denying the fact that boat shoes literally look like shoes that should be worn on a boat. The decorative lacing that wraps around the body of the shoe has a very nautical vibe to it, adhering to the famous name. They are also known for having razor-cut soles to help with grip. Though boat shoes are very casual, they often have subtle yet nice detailing in them that does not go unnoticed. 

Loafers

Loafers

pixabay.com

Loafers are perhaps most famous for their slip-on design, making them easy and convenient to put on Though they have no laces, their easy-to-use design means that there is no real reason to have laces in the first place. While this does mean that loafers are perhaps as comfortable as a shoe can be, it is extra important to make sure that you always get the correct size when buying a pair since you won’t have the option of tightening the shoes with laces if needed. 

Key Differences Between the Two

Boat Shoe vs. Loafer

Pinterest

The biggest difference between boat shoes and loafers is the fact that loafers will never have laces. Ever. Boat shoes on the other hand almost always have a long lace that is made of either leather or nylon. Another difference between the two is the outsoles. Boat shoes were designed with rubber outsoles, keeping a sailor on a slippery boat deck in mind.

The rubber outsoles provide ample traction and grip, while loafers often have leather outsoles or even a synthetic combination of rubber or leather. Also, being that loafers were originally inspired by moccasins, it is no surprise that loafers are seen as a more casual type of shoe.

However, when compared to boat shoes, some loafers can pass as smart-casual, while boat shoes are strictly casual through and through. Though this might seem surprising the often rigid shape of boat shoes, they are also seen as the more comfortable option, often unbeatable when compared to other kinds of footwear. 

Similarities Between the Two

Similarities Boat Shoes vs. Loafers

themanual.com

While there are some important differences between the two, it is impossible to ignore the very obvious similarities that exist as well. For one, both boat shoes and loafers have heels (though loafer heels are often higher). Another similarity can be found in the stitched upper seams on both kinds of footwear. 

Overall, if you’re having a hard time choosing between the two shoes, just remember that loafers can be a bit more dressed up than boat shoes, but boat shoes are a tad more comfortable and can be worn without issue for longer periods of time.
